What Is Vex 3 Hooda Math?
Vex 3 is the third installment in the Vex series of platformer games, known for its smooth controls, creative levels, and challenging puzzles. It’s hosted on Hooda Math, a website famous for educational and entertaining games that promote critical thinking and problem-solving skills. Unlike traditional platform games, Vex 3 mixes elements of timing, precision, and spatial reasoning, making it a favorite among players who enjoy combining reflexes with mental agility.

Gameplay Mechanics and Features
Understanding the core mechanics of Vex 3 is essential for progressing through the increasingly difficult levels. The game challenges players to control a stick figure avatar through labyrinthine courses filled with spikes, rotating blades, and narrow ledges.
Controls and Movement
The gameplay is intuitive yet precise. Using arrow keys or WASD, you can move your character left, right, jump, and crouch. Mastering the timing of jumps and the subtle use of crouching to slip through tight spaces is crucial. The physics engine in Vex 3 means that momentum matters—a well-timed jump can save you from falling into deadly traps.
Level Design and Challenges
Vex 3 features a variety of level designs that test different skills:
- Timing-Based Obstacles: Swinging blades and moving platforms require patience and perfect timing.
- Maze-Like Layouts: Some levels feel like puzzles where you must find the safest path.
- Hidden Shortcuts: Exploring levels carefully can reveal shortcuts that save time.
- Checkpoint Systems: Frequent checkpoints help reduce frustration by saving progress after difficult sections.
The diversity in level design keeps the gameplay fresh and rewards players who explore and experiment.
Tips for Excelling in Vex 3 Hooda Math
Whether you’re a beginner or looking to improve your completion time, these tips can help you overcome the toughest challenges in Vex 3.
Practice Makes Perfect
The first key to success is patience. Don’t rush through the levels; instead, focus on learning the patterns of obstacles. Each trap has a rhythm, and once you understand it, you can time your moves precisely.
Use Checkpoints Wisely
Pay attention to checkpoint locations. If you’re stuck on a difficult section, try to reach the checkpoint before attempting the tricky part repeatedly. This prevents losing too much progress and keeps frustration at bay.
Plan Your Route
Some levels have multiple pathways or optional routes. Take a moment to plan your moves, especially in maze-like sections. Sometimes the longer path is safer, while other times a risky shortcut can save precious seconds.
Stay Calm Under Pressure
Many of Vex 3’s challenges require quick reflexes, but panicking often leads to mistakes. Keep a steady pace and stay focused, especially when facing sequences of obstacles.

Exploring the Vex Series on Hooda Math
If you enjoy Vex 3, you might want to explore earlier or related titles in the Vex series. Each game builds on the mechanics of the last while introducing new obstacles and gameplay elements.
Vex 1 and Vex 2
The first two games lay the foundation for the series with simpler levels and basic mechanics. Playing these can be a great warm-up to understand the game physics and controls before tackling the more advanced challenges in Vex 3.
Vex 4 and Beyond
Later installments like Vex 4 continue to evolve the gameplay, adding more complex puzzles and interactive elements. For dedicated fans, these sequels offer a deeper experience and expanded worlds to explore.

Understanding Vex 3 Hooda Math: Gameplay and Educational Value
Vex 3 stands out as a platformer that blends traditional game mechanics with a subtle emphasis on strategic thinking. Unlike typical math games that focus explicitly on numerical problems or equations, Vex 3 Hooda Math challenges players to develop logical reasoning through spatial navigation and trial-and-error learning. This approach aligns with modern educational paradigms that favor experiential learning and problem-solving over rote memorization.
At its core, the game requires players to maneuver a stick figure through a series of increasingly difficult levels filled with traps, moving platforms, and environmental hazards. Success depends on anticipating obstacles, timing jumps precisely, and understanding the physics of the game environment. These tasks, while not overtly mathematical, engage the same cognitive faculties involved in mathematical reasoning — such as pattern recognition, critical thinking, and sequential logic.
Features That Define Vex 3 in the Hooda Math Series
Several key features distinguish Vex 3 as a standout title within Hooda Math’s offerings:
- Progressive Difficulty: The game’s levels gradually increase in complexity, introducing new elements like spikes, moving saw blades, and teleporters that require players to adapt their strategies continuously.
- Intuitive Controls: Responsive keyboard controls allow for precise movement, essential for mastering the timing-based challenges that define Vex 3.
- Checkpoint System: Frequent checkpoints reduce frustration by allowing players to restart from the last safe point rather than the beginning of the level, encouraging experimentation.
- Minimalist Design: The simple aesthetic keeps players focused on gameplay mechanics without unnecessary distractions.
These features collectively contribute to a gameplay experience that is both accessible for younger audiences and challenging enough to engage more experienced players.
